3. Social Media: Threat or Opportunity?
Social media can be a double-edged sword for companies:
Threats:
- Negative Publicity: Viral complaints or misinformation can damage reputation.
- Employee Misconduct: Inappropriate social media use can lead to legal or ethical issues.
- Security Breaches: Data leaks through social media can have serious consequences.
Opportunities:
- Brand Building: Connect with customers, build loyalty, and control your narrative.
- Market Research: Gain valuable insights into customer preferences and trends.
- Innovation: Crowdsource ideas and foster collaboration with customers and partners.
Advice for Companies:
- Develop a Social Media Strategy: Define goals, target audience, and appropriate platforms.
- Train Employees: Educate them on responsible social media use and company policies.
- Monitor and Engage: Actively listen to customers, address concerns, and build positive relationships.
Remember, social media is a powerful tool that requires careful management for success.

1. Strategic Management for All:
Strategic management isn't just about the top; it's about everyone playing their part! Here's why:
- Alignment: Understanding the bigger picture helps individuals connect their daily tasks to overall goals, boosting motivation and engagement.
- Adaptability: A dynamic business landscape requires everyone to be adaptable. Strategic awareness helps anticipate changes and adjust accordingly.
- Informed Decisions: Even seemingly small decisions can impact strategy. Shared understanding empowers individuals to make informed choices.
2. The Effective Mission Statement:
A great mission statement is clear, concise, and inspiring. It should:
- Define Purpose: Briefly explain what the company does and why it exists.
- Be Unique: Reflect the company's values and differentiate it from competitors.
- Motivate: Inspire employees and stakeholders with a shared vision.
- Guide Actions: Provide a framework for decision-making and resource allocation.
